The mission of the Pacific Research Institute (PRI) is to champion freedom, opportunity, and personal responsibility for all individuals by advancing free-market policy solutions. Since its founding in 1979, PRI has remained steadfast to the vision of a free and civil society where individuals can achieve their full potential. Put simply, public policy is too important to be left just to the experts. Individuals are the real decision makers when it comes to their schools, health care, and environment. PRI reinforces this ideal by providing you with the information, inspiration, and opportunity to make decisions about the daily issues that matter most to you. The Institute’s activities include publications, events, media commentary, legislative testimony, and community outreach.

The Young Leaders Circle of PRI’s Sir Antony Fisher Freedom Society brings together young professionals between the ages of 21-40 who are interested in the ideas of liberty. Through engagement with PRI’s high-caliber programs and events, Young Leaders Circle members can network, learn more about today’s pressing public policy issues, and become more effective advocates for liberty.
